This is an adaptation of a webnovel, and the story is much longer than the manga will likely ever get to, so if it interests you at all, I strongly recommend tracking down the webnovel and reading it. It pushes the limits of suspension of disbelief, mostly because the teachers and even the administration stick up for the bullied boy instead of sweeping it under the rug and letting the rich star athlete go scot-free, but at the same time, it’s very satisfying, for just that reason. It’s essentially a fairy tale in which good triumphs over evil.
